From fire to forest
Fire keeps this land bare. We work with the Indigenous Miskito communities of La Mosquitia to stop it, and the forest comes back on its own.
The human stakes
Stopping the fires means working with the people who live here. Paskaia began as an initiative from the Miskito community itself, and every brigade and nursery is run by local hands.
How it works
The seedlings are already in the ground. They just burn before they can grow. Stop the fires, and whole stretches of savanna turn back into young forest. That is how we restore thousands of hectares at once, not plot by plot.

Why you can count on us
Paskaia is certified under Plan Vivo, the standard built to put communities at the centre of restoration. It sets the rules for how we monitor, report and share the money, and at least 60% of credit revenue goes straight to the communities. We're certified under V4 and migrating to V5, working toward Core Carbon Principles approval. The standard changes. The work on the ground doesn't.
